Developing a contrarian mindset takes time and experience from "summary" of Contrarian Investment Strategies in the Next Generation by David Dreman
To truly embrace a contrarian mindset, one must be willing to challenge conventional wisdom and go against the crowd. This is not something that can be achieved overnight; it requires time and experience to develop the necessary skills and confidence to swim against the tide of popular opinion. It is a process that involves learning from both successes and failures, and gradually building a mental framework that enables one to see opportunities where others see only risk.
